About the role: Our IT team is seeking a Head of Business Applications to support our growing IT landscape, with a particular focus on Microsoft Azure. The Head of Business Applications leads the strategic direction, development, and support of enterprise applications across the organisation. This role is pivotal in driving digital transformation, improving operational efficiency, and ensuring that business systems align with organisational goals. The postholder will manage a multidisciplinary team, oversee vendor relationships, and ensure robust governance across the application landscape. Key Responsibilities: Overseeing the development and enhancement of systems and integrating new systems with existing system. Ensure the smooth operation and maintenance of business applications by providing support and troubleshooting and coordinating with the wider IT teams to resolve any issues as they arise. Effective leadership of a diverse team of skilled IT professionals across multiple locations. Foster a culture of innovation, collaboration, and continuous improvement. Act as liaison between business units and technical teams, ensuring clear communication and strategic alignment. Define and document best practices and support procedures. Provide expertise to Projects and Business Service Requests as required to ensure tasks and milestones are achieved in a timely manner. Coach and mentor individual team members on an ongoing basis, review performance, setting out goals and objectives annually. Provide advice and guidance where appropriate in relation to incidents, service requests and/or projects to ensure the successful completion of said items. Monitor application performance and implement improvements for scalability and reliability. Manage 3rd party vendors ensuring their delivery is on-time and meets Flogas standards. Work closely with the Head of architecture & development team to set the technical direction of application/ software builds and ensure the tech stack is modern and scalable. Ensure agile best practices, automation and efficient delivery of projects with a clearly defined process (Use of devops for traceability, Peer reviews, unit tests for code, pipelines for all deployments, etc). Work closely with the business stakeholders to ensure they have a clear view on IT delivery. Candidate Profile: Technical Knowledge of Microsoft Azure Cloud frameworks. Development Stack: C#, .NET, React, JavaScript, HTML/CSS, JSON/XML APIs. Good knowledge of quality standards and best practice. Low-Code Platforms: Power Platform (PowerApps, Power Automate). Experience: Bachelor's degree or higher in Computer Science, Information Technology, related field, or equivalent experience required. 5+ years' experience in a leadership role focused on business solutions and applications with extensive involvement in the full life cycle of solution delivery from inception, through design and deployment. Extensive experience of working with partners and Systems Integrators to deliver complex IT/Digital enterprise platforms and solutions, and ERP platforms. Experience in Energy markets and systems (Desirable). Demonstrates clear and effective verbal and written communication skills with all levels of staff, both business and technical. Passionate about emerging technologies such as AI that can help add value to the business and increase efficiencies. Strong organisational skills and excellent attention to detail, with demonstrable experience of a project-management approach in delivering longer term goals. Strong personal commitment to succeed. Ability to manage priorities in a fast-paced environment. Analytical and problem-solving skills. About Flogas: Part of the DCC Group, Flogas Ireland was established in 1978 supplying Liquefied Petroleum Gas (LPG) throughout the island and to this day remains one of the leading suppliers in Ireland, servicing a diverse range of market sectors, including commercial, agricultural, and domestic. Over the years, Flogas has evolved and grown as an Energy business, and with the acquisition of Budget Energy, based in Derry, and Flogas Enterprise Solutions, (formally known as Naturgy) we are now also a leading supplier of Natural Gas and Electricity, as well as Renewables, including Corporate Power Purchase Agreements, and energy services in both residential and commercial markets across the island of Ireland. Flogas actively supports micro-generation, which involves generating electricity from renewable sources such as solar photovoltaic (PV), micro-wind, micro-hydro, and micro-renewable combined heat and power We have an esteemed reputation within the Energy Industry and have been awarded the NSAI Quality System Certificate from the I.S. EN ISO 9001 Series. As a Flogas Group, we are now driving our growth strategy to achieve our vision of being Irelands leading provider of total energy solutions, meeting our customers changing needs and delivering to the highest possible standard.
